2013-01-10 42 views
0

我一直试图让我的应用程序在成功进入Google Play商店后为iPhone工作。我发现iPhone的过程比我预期的要糟糕。IOS 6.0忽略我的启动图像

我的问题是,虽然我有启动图像指定为每个显示器,当我在iOS 6.0模拟器或iPhone 5测试我得到愚蠢的默认启动图像,而不是我指定的。

我以为我有东西配置错了,但是当我在IOS 5.0模拟器上尝试它的想法时,它很有用!这是非常令人沮丧的。

我正在使用XCODE来做这个'视觉'。我是一个小菜鸟,以确保如何在.plist中手动执行此操作,并且我无法从Apple找到任何有关它的真实文档。

我可以肯定地使用一些实际有用的文档的链接,甚至有人经历过相同的事情并找到解决方案的人的帮助。

谢谢!

BTW:我使用的Xcode 4.5.2

+2

确保您已清除所有目标。此外,它可能有助于从所有模拟器中删除应用程序。 –

+0

干净清洁:我正在清洁和清洁没有效果。 删除应用程序的确有窍门。非常感谢你的建议! 如果你已经发布这个'答案',我肯定会把它标记为正确的。 –

回答

1

有几件事情来检查......

首先,您的命名约定:

Default.png(320×480),用于支持原来的iPhone通iPhone 3GS

支持的iPhone 4 [email protected](640×960)和4S

[email protected](640 x 1136)用于支持iPhone 5

电容分析计数,所以要小心。

其次,确保每个图像是72 dpi。

第三,从Xcode上做一个产品 - >清理,以确保你已经摆脱了躺在周围的任何旧文件。同时从模拟器中删除应用程序,然后再次运行。

最后,尝试在实际硬件上运行。虽然模拟器非常好,但它们的工作方式有一些差异 - 特别是它们如何适应图像。

+1

感谢您的回答,但它不是名称或运行清晰:它是在再次运行之前从模拟器中删除应用程序。 所以这意味着当使用模拟或实际手机进行测试时,如果应用程序已经存在,它会保留旧的启动图像。这对苹果公司的某个人来说可能是有意义的。 –